Cozieni is a village located in Romania, situated at coordinates 45.33333, 26.48333. It is part of the Buzău County in the southeastern region of the country. This village is known for its picturesque rural landscapes and traditional Romanian architecture, reflecting the culture of the area.
Cozieni operates within the Europe/Bucharest timezone, which is UTC+2, and observes daylight saving time, shifting to UTC+3 in summer. The village is significant regionally due to its agricultural activities and its proximity to natural attractions in the Buzău County, making it a quaint destination for those interested in exploring the rural heart of Romania.
Timezone in Cozieni
Cozieni is located in the Europe/Bucharest timezone, which has a UTC offset of +2 hours during standard time. When daylight saving time is in effect, typically from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the offset shifts to UTC +3 hours. This seasonal change allows for longer daylight during the evenings in the warmer months.
